Plan your run at Forest Preserves of Cook County

The practical stuff

  • AccessHours vary — hours are not posted for this trail, so check before an early or late run
  • SurfacePaved — asphalt or concrete. Fast and predictable, runnable year-round, and fine with a stroller
  • Distance25 mi as reported — check whether that is one way or a round trip before you commit. Long enough for a real long run.
  • ShadeNot reported. Assume some of it is exposed and carry water in summer.
  • At the trailheadparking, water — reported by runners
